Training Description
This self-paced Installing and Configuring Windows 7 technical training course will introduce beginning and intermediate users to Windows 7. This course will cover new features, deployment options and other issues involved with moving to the Windows 7 platform. Students will learn how to install, deploy, manage and troubleshoot Windows 7 in and out of the enterprise environment.
Training Objectives
At completion of the course students will be able to:
- Install Windows 7
- Configure Windows 7
- Manage Windows 7 in the enterprise
- Perform basic tasks
- Explore various security features within Windows 7
- Troubleshoot
Prerequisites
Students should have an understanding of the Windows desktop and basic networking.
